Ensure your student's USI VET Transcripts are up to date
Keeping VET transcripts update to date supports students to verify completed training.
We would like to remind all Registered Training Organisations (RTOs) of the importance of keeping USI VET Transcripts current and accurate. VET transcripts are essential for students as they use them to apply for jobs and to verify past training for credit transfers.
There may be occasions where information on a VET transcript is inaccurate or incomplete. As an RTO, collecting and reporting your students’ training data is required annually or quarterly to the National VET Provider Collections. We encourage RTOs to report on a quarterly basis so students can have their VET Transcript updated more frequently with nationally recognised training appearing around 6 weeks after each collection period.
Quarterly reporting also reduces the end of year reporting workload and brings resolution of reporting issues closer to the time of original data capture.
It is important to note that neither the USI team nor the NCVER are able to make any corrections to a VET transcript. All incoming calls from students regarding their inaccurate or incomplete VET transcripts are referred to their respective RTO.
